A Woodstock man and woman were arrested following the assault of a cab driver in Ingersoll
A man and woman have been charged following the assault of a cab driver in Ingersoll.
The incident occurred during the early hours of February 22nd when the driver picked up the two at a residence on Ingersoll Street North.
The driver was assaulted and the suspects then fled the scene.
After a police investigation, Oxford OPP arrested 28 year-old Tyler Lyttle and 19 year-old Samantha Toellner both of Woodstock.
Lyttle has been charged with assault and uttering threats to cause death or bodily harm while Toellner was arrested for obstruction of justice. The two were released from custody on the promise to appear in court April 15th.
